The Ontario energy company had been trying for four years to get approval for what would have been Alberta's first nuclear power plant. Elena Schacherl is chair of Citizens Advocating the Use of Sustainable Energy, a member organization of the coalition Keep Alberta Nuclear Free. She explains the factors that went into Bruce Power's decision to pull out.
